MLB: San Francisco 6, Florida 5

SAN FRANCISCO, Aug. 21 (UPI) -- A sacrifice fly by Bengie Molina in the bottom of the ninth inning Wednesday gave the San Francisco Giants a 6-5 win over the Florida Marlins.

The Giants loaded the bases on a walk to Dave Roberts, a single by Randy Winn and an intentional walk to Aaron Rowand. Molina then hit a fly to deep center field to end the game.

The Marlins' John Baker had tied the contest in the top of the ninth with a pinch-hit, three-run homer.

Winn hit a solo home run for the Giants, who have won four of their last six games.

Jeremy Hermida belted a two-run homer for Florida.

Reliever Brian Wilson (1-2) gave up the homer to Baker but picked up the win.

Matt Lindstrom (1-2) took the loss.
